#3778d3 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3778d3 is composed of 21.6% red, 47.1% green and 82.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 73.9% cyan, 43.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 17.3% black. It has a hue angle of 215 degrees, a saturation of 63.9% and a lightness of 52.2%. #3778d3 color hex could be obtained by blending #6ef0ff with #0000a7. Closest websafe color is: #3366cc.

#3778d3 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3778d3 has RGB values of R:55, G:120, B:211 and CMYK values of C:0.74, M:0.43, Y:0, K:0.17. Its decimal value is 3635411.

Shades and Tints of #3778d3
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020509 is the darkest color, while #f8fafd is the lightest one.

Tones of #3778d3
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#828588 is the less saturated color, while #1172f9 is the most saturated one.
